Discussions on WindowsForum.com about chrome clones focus on how many browsers, including Opera, Maxthon, Edge, and even Firefox, have adopted the look and feel of Google Chrome. Users express frustration with the lack of originality and the stale, boring nature of these clones. However, Vivaldi is highlighted as a refreshing exception. While it uses Chrome's Blink engine and supports Chrome extensions, Vivaldi offers a unique interface reminiscent of the old Opera browser. Developed by former Opera co-founder Jón S. von Tetzchner, Vivaldi is praised for its customization and promising future, standing out among the sea of chrome clones.
